How much do full time data analyst jobs pay per year?

As of Aug 6, 2026, the average yearly pay for full time data analyst in Minnesota is $80,939.00,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$61,200.00 and $95,000.00 per year, depending on experience, location, and employer.

What does a full time data analyst do?

A Full Time Data Analyst is responsible for collecting, processing, and analyzing large sets of data to help organizations make informed decisions. They use statistical tools and techniques to interpret data trends and patterns, create reports and visualizations, and present actionable insights to stakeholders. Data analysts often work with databases, spreadsheets, and specialized software to ensure data accuracy and reliability. Their work supports business strategies, improves efficiency, and identifies opportunities for growth.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a full time data analyst, and why are they important?

To thrive as a Full Time Data Analyst, you need strong analytical skills, proficiency in statistics, and a relevant degree such as in mathematics, statistics, or computer science. Familiarity with data analysis tools like SQL, Python, Excel, and visualization platforms such as Tableau or Power BI is typically required. Strong problem-solving abilities, communication skills, and attention to detail help analysts present actionable insights and collaborate effectively with stakeholders. These skills and qualifications are crucial for transforming raw data into meaningful information that drives business decisions.

What is the opportunity?
Working in a fast-paced, agile environment, the Salesforce Data & Reporting Analyst/Senior Analyst will be responsible for identifying and collecting data sources, analyzing and extracting key data and information, evaluating and monitoring data quality to meet the organization's information system needs and requirements. Partnering with developers and font office users, you will manage Salesforce data integration and ensure data integrity and quality.
What will you do?
  • Manage end-to-end data integration in Salesforce
  • Assists and participates in data validation and cleaning to ensure the quality and integrity of data
  • Analyzes and extracts key data and information to meet the organization's information system needs and requirements
  • Assist data users with validating data and troubleshooting Salesforce data integrity issues
  • Partner with stakeholders and technology teams to align system capabilities with business' evolving needs
  • Act as a resource for team members for troubleshooting and support

What do you need to succeed?
Must-have
  • 1-2 years of Salesforce data integration, administration, and reporting related experience or for Senior, 3+ years of experience
  • Experience leveraging/writing SQL in database integration and data transfer projects
  • Salesforce Platform Administrator/System Administrator
  • Salesforce App Builder
  • Strong communication Skills

Nice-to-have
  • Salesforce Platform Administrator 2/Advanced System Administrator
  • Salesforce Platform Data Architect
  • Salesforce Platform Sharing and Visibility Architect
